How to get to Prague

Planning a trip to Prague from the UK offers a delightful adventure into the heart of the Czech Republic, renowned for its stunning architecture and rich history. Most UK holidaymakers find flying to be the most convenient travel option, with direct flights available from major airports such as London Heathrow, Gatwick, Manchester, and Edinburgh. These flights, often operated by British Airways, easyJet, and Ryanair, typically land at Václav Havel Airport Prague, which is about 12 kilometres west of the city centre. Upon arrival, navigating through this modern and well-organised airport is a breeze, especially with its clear signage and efficient public transport connections. For a seamless transition to the city, consider using the Airport Express bus service or the more economical public buses, which connect directly to the city’s metro network. Pre-booking a taxi or a private transfer can offer a more comfortable and tailored travel experience, particularly for those with ample luggage. It’s also wise to familiarise yourself with Czech currency, the koruna, to ensure smooth transactions throughout your stay. Before you embark on your journey, checking in online and downloading relevant travel and city guides can enhance your trip, providing valuable insights and tips that ensure you make the most of your visit to Prague.

Local Culture in Prague

Prague, the enchanting heart of the Czech Republic, offers UK holidaymakers a captivating blend of rich traditions, charming customs, and warm hospitality that is sure to enhance any visit. The city’s vibrant culture is steeped in history, reflected in everything from the Gothic spires of its old town to the lively festivals that punctuate the year. Understanding local etiquette can make your stay more enjoyable; Czech people value politeness and formality, so it’s customary to greet with a friendly “Dobrý den” (Good day) and say “Na shledanou” (Goodbye) when parting. Observing quiet tones in public places and removing shoes before entering homes can also show respect for local customs. Moreover, delving into the language by learning a few basic Czech phrases often earns appreciation and can bridge cultural gaps. Embrace these cultural nuances, and you’ll find Prague’s unique charm revealed in its warm people, historical intrigue, and welcoming way of life.

Practical tips for holidays to Prague

Discovering the enchanting city of Prague in the Czech Republic can be a seamless experience with some practical tips under your belt. The local currency is the Czech koruna (CZK), and to avoid unfavourable exchange rates, it’s wise to use ATMs or reputable exchange offices; steer clear of shady street vendors. Travelling around Prague is a breeze thanks to its efficient public transportation network, including trams, buses, and the metro. Consider purchasing a travel pass for unlimited journeys, which can be a cost-effective solution for moving around the city. When venturing to popular sites like the Old Town Square or Charles Bridge, explore during early mornings or late evenings to dodge the crowds and truly soak in the historical charm. Opt for comfortable walking shoes as the city’s cobblestone streets are best admired on foot, but don’t hesitate to hop on a tram to cover longer distances swiftly. By keeping these tips in mind, your Prague adventure is bound to be an unforgettable one.

Best time to visit Prague

Visiting Prague in the Czech Republic offers distinct charms throughout the year, making it a versatile destination. The best times to explore this picturesque city depend on your preferences for weather, prices, and tourist traffic. Spring, from March to May, is an enchanting period when mild temperatures and blossoming parks create an idyllic setting for sightseeing, and accommodation prices are still moderate. Summer, between June and August, heralds the peak tourist season with warm, sun-drenched days perfect for alfresco dining and river cruises, though you’ll encounter higher prices and bustling crowds. Autumn, from September to November, showcases the city in a stunning display of red and gold foliage, with cooler weather making it ideal for leisurely strolls, while hotel rates become more appealing as the crowds thin. Winter, spanning December to February, transforms Prague into a winter wonderland; the Christmas markets and snow-dusted spires create a magical ambiance, and although the temperatures drop, the reduced tourist traffic and off-peak prices offer a more intimate and cost-effective experience. Each season in Prague delivers its own unique allure, ensuring that whenever you choose to visit, the city will enchant you with its timeless beauty and rich history.
